Developed by Rocscience, a company founded by researchers from the University of Toronto, the software became an industry standard due to its ability to handle a wide variety of geological materials, including soil, rock, and reinforced earth structures.

If you are a student or researcher, your university may already have an active institutional license for Rocscience products. Rocscience offers heavily discounted or free educational packages directly to verified academic institutions. Slide includes a free viewer that allows opening and reviewing existing .slmd files, printing, and copying results – but not editing or running new analyses.
